Husargatan is a bus stop located in Luleå, Sweden. It serves as a transit point for local bus services, facilitating public transportation within the city and connecting passengers to various destinations. The bus stop is part of the broader public transport network that aims to provide efficient mobility options for residents and visitors.
The area around Husargatan is characterized by a mix of residential and commercial properties, contributing to the daily foot traffic at the bus stop. Public transport in Luleå is managed by Luleå Lokaltrafik, which operates multiple bus routes that include stops at Husargatan.
